I fixed a race condition in the parallel building of ARM in commit
3939f3345050 ("ARM: 8418/1: add boot image dependencies to not
generate invalid images").

I see the same problem for MicroBlaze too.

"make -j<N> ARCH=microblaze all linux.bin.ub" results in a broken build
because two threads descend into arch/microblaze/boot simultaneously.

Add proper dependencies to avoid it.
